How a Septic System Functions

Septic systems are self-contained wastewater treatment systems commonly used in rural areas where municipal sewage systems are unavailable. They work by treating and disposing of household wastewater in a manner that minimizes environmental impact. Here’s a breakdown of how a septic system operates.

Basic Components of a Septic System

A typical septic system consists of three main components:

  • Septic Tank: This underground tank collects wastewater from the home. It allows solids to settle at the bottom, forming sludge, while lighter materials like grease float to the top, forming scum.
  • Drain Field: Also known as a leach field, this area consists of perforated pipes buried in gravel or sand. It allows treated wastewater to seep into the soil, where it undergoes further natural filtration.
  • Soil: The soil plays a crucial role in filtering and treating the wastewater as it percolates through the ground. Healthy soil can effectively break down harmful pathogens and nutrients.

How Wastewater is Processed

1. Wastewater Collection: When you flush a toilet, run the dishwasher, or take a shower, wastewater flows through the plumbing system into the septic tank.

2. Separation of Solids and Liquids: Inside the septic tank, solids settle to the bottom, while liquids rise to the top. The tank is designed to hold wastewater long enough for this separation to occur.

3. Anaerobic Digestion: Bacteria in the tank break down the solid waste, reducing its volume. This process occurs without oxygen, which is why the tank is sealed.

4. Effluent Discharge: The liquid effluent, now partially treated, flows out of the septic tank and into the drain field through a series of pipes.

5. Soil Filtration: As the effluent seeps into the soil, it undergoes additional treatment through natural filtration. The soil microorganisms further break down contaminants, making the water safe to return to the groundwater.

Variations by State and Type of System

The design and regulations surrounding septic systems can vary significantly based on location and type. Here are some factors that influence how septic systems work:

Factor Variation Impact
State Regulations Different states have varying codes and requirements for septic systems. Some states may require more advanced treatment systems, while others may allow simpler designs.
Soil Type Soil composition can vary widely, affecting drainage and filtration. Clay soils may require a different system design compared to sandy soils, which drain quickly.
System Type Conventional vs. Alternative Systems Conventional systems are common, but alternative systems (like aerobic treatment units) may be necessary in challenging conditions.
Insurance Coverage Homeowners insurance policies may vary in coverage for septic systems. Some policies may cover repairs, while others may not, depending on the circumstances.

Exceptions and Conditions

While septic systems are generally effective, several factors can influence their performance:

  • System Size: The size of the septic system must match the household’s wastewater output. An undersized system can lead to backups and failures.
  • Maintenance: Regular pumping and maintenance are essential. Neglecting these tasks can lead to system failure.
  • Water Usage: Excessive water usage can overwhelm the system, leading to inefficiencies and potential failures.
  • Environmental Conditions: Heavy rainfall or flooding can saturate the drain field, reducing its ability to absorb wastewater.

Understanding how a septic system works, along with its variations and potential pitfalls, is vital for homeowners to ensure their systems operate effectively and efficiently.

Regular Maintenance is Key

One of the most critical aspects of septic system management is regular maintenance. Here are some key practices to follow:

  • Pumping the Tank: It is generally recommended to pump your septic tank every 3 to 5 years, depending on household size and water usage. For example, a family of four may need to pump their tank every 3 years, while a single occupant might stretch it to 5 years.
  • Inspecting Components: Regularly check the tank and drain field for signs of trouble, such as odors, wet spots, or slow drains. Early detection can prevent costly repairs.
  • Keep Records: Maintain a log of all maintenance activities, including pumping dates, repairs, and inspections. This information can be invaluable when selling your home or addressing issues.

Water Usage Management

Managing water usage can significantly impact the health of your septic system. Here are some strategies:

  1. Spread Out Water Usage: Instead of doing all laundry in one day, spread it out over the week to avoid overwhelming the system.
  2. Fix Leaks: A dripping faucet or running toilet can add up to hundreds of gallons of water each month, putting unnecessary strain on your septic system.
  3. Install Water-Efficient Fixtures: Low-flow toilets and showerheads can reduce water usage without sacrificing performance.

What to Avoid

Being aware of common mistakes can save you time and money. Here are some pitfalls to avoid:

  • Flushing Non-Biodegradable Items: Items like wipes, feminine hygiene products, and paper towels should never be flushed. They can clog the system and lead to costly repairs.
  • Using Harsh Chemicals: Avoid pouring bleach, solvents, or other harsh chemicals down the drain. These substances can kill the beneficial bacteria in your septic tank, disrupting the treatment process.
  • Neglecting the Drain Field: Never park vehicles or place heavy objects on the drain field. This can compact the soil and prevent proper drainage.

Cost Ranges for Maintenance

Understanding the potential costs associated with septic system maintenance can help you budget effectively:

Service Estimated Cost
Pumping the Septic Tank $250 – $500
Septic System Inspection $100 – $300
Repairs (Minor) $500 – $1,500
Septic System Replacement $3,000 – $10,000

Statistical Data on Septic Systems

According to the United States Environmental Protection Agency (EPA):

  • Approximately 20% of U.S. households rely on septic systems for wastewater treatment.
  • Septic systems treat about 4 billion gallons of wastewater daily across the country.
  • Improperly maintained septic systems can lead to groundwater contamination, affecting drinking water sources.

The National Association of Home Builders (NAHB) reports that:

  • Homes with septic systems are often located in areas where municipal sewer systems are not available, particularly in rural regions.
  • Septic systems can last anywhere from 20 to 30 years with proper maintenance, but neglect can significantly shorten their lifespan.
